农用三轮车车架结构优化设计

Optimization design of agricultural tricycle frame structure

  • 摘要: 针对目前国内市场农用三轮车车架结构一致性问题,对某农用三轮车车架进行新型结构优化设计。以大梁式车架为研究对象,通过拓扑优化和尺寸优化方法与有限元分析相结合,充分考虑制造工艺性与经济性,在满足车架原始性能基础上,设计满足市场需求的新型桁架式三轮车车架,对其他车型车架轻量化设计具有一定的参考价值。

     

    Abstract: Aiming at frame structure consistency problems of agricultural tricycles in domestic market, a new structural optimization design for an agricultural tricycle frame was carried out.Taking girder frame as a research object, topology optimization and size optimization methods were combined with finite element analysis.Manufacturing process and economy were fully considered during design process.On the basis of satisfying original performance of frame, a new truss-type tricycle frame met current market demand was designed, which has certain reference value for lightweight design of other vehicle frames.
